Dermoptera Synonyms & Definitions

• DermopteraDefinition & Meaning in English

  1. (n. pl.) An order of Mammalia; the Cheiroptera.
  2. (n. pl.) A group of lemuroid mammals having a parachutelike web of skin between the fore and hind legs, of which the colugo (Galeopithecus) is the type. See Colugo.
  3. (n. pl.) The division of insects which includes the earwigs (Forticulidae).

• DermopteranDefinition & Meaning in English

  1. (n.) An insect which has the anterior pair of wings coriaceous, and does not use them in flight, as the earwig.